- Kjer BollJul 14, 2024 · 2 years agoThe trading hours of futures markets can have a significant impact on the volatility of digital currencies. When futures markets are open, it provides an additional avenue for traders to speculate on the price movements of digital currencies. This increased trading activity can lead to higher volatility as more participants enter the market. Additionally, the availability of futures contracts allows traders to take both long and short positions, which can further contribute to price fluctuations. Overall, the trading hours of futures markets play a crucial role in shaping the volatility of digital currencies.
